Be sensible young Wizards, and ask yourselves if this person is really going to give you an item worth $30 of real money just for a few free Treasure Cards - the answer is, no, they're not. They're going to take your Treasure Cards and disappear. It's not a very nice thing to do, but all trades must be agreed upon by both parties. If the trade sounds too good to be true, it probably is, so don't accept the trade.

Please remember, reporting someone for 'scamming' you out of Treasure Cards is not valid, since you both had to agree to the trade. If what you see in the Trade window is not fair, regardless of what the player told you, don't agree to the trade, simple as that. Caveat emptor is a very powerful lesson to learn, young Wizards. Buyer Beware.

If he approached you first and offered a crowns item for cards, you get the item first. If you were yelling in the commons that you would trade cards for a crowns item, well, you were scammer-bait to begin with. Crowns items are only tradeable at point of purchase, i.e., they cost real money, can't trade a dropped crowns item. Few people are going to give you a costly item in return for a few free cards.
Use common sense when trading.

I understand why you have made this suggestion.

However, this would hurt those players with multiple accounts that use a single account for storing treasure cards for crafting. I trade among my various accounts and have one account (all six wizards of the account) as a storage area for all of my treasure cards - that's 42 pages of treasure cards (7 pages per wizard). Therefore, my trades are usually one way - either making a deposit or a withdrawn from the one account.

By using the one account as storage I don't have search through all of the other accounts to find the cards that I need for crafting.
